Seasonal flavours debut at Vancouver’s Bel Café

Celebrate the holidays with new pastries, comforting classics, and winter-inspired drinks

Vancouver, B.C. (November 14, 2025)Bel Café, the vibrant downtown eatery helmed by acclaimed Chef David Hawksworth, is delighted to unveil its festive holiday menu. This year’s offerings showcase an inviting selection of pastries, sweets, and winter beverages crafted to bring warmth and cheer to the season. Guests are invited to indulge in nostalgic holiday treats or enjoy a cozy lunch while exploring downtown Vancouver.

Bel Café and Hawksworth Restaurant’s esteemed Pastry Chef, Marissa Gonzalez, has created a delicious trio of Assorted Holiday Cookies featuring Linzer & Raspberry, Ginger Molasses and Vanilla Shortbread ($3.25 each or 12 for $38). Bel’s Traditional Fruit Cake ($25) also returns, brimming with dark rum–soaked dried fruits, citrus zest, and finished with festive marzipan. New this year are several indulgent pastries, including the Mont Blanc Croissant ($7.95) with chestnut and milk chocolate crèmeux, the Gingerbread & Biscoff Cream Puff ($7.25), the Eggnog & Cinnamon Croissant ($7.25), and the refined Pear & Almond Frangipane Tartlet ($7.25). 

In addition to these sweet offerings, Bel Café also highlights two comforting savoury favourites perfect for a mid-day break. The Holiday Turkey Sandwich ($18.00) brings together smoked turkey, brie, cranberry, arugula, and aioli on multigrain for a festive, hearty bite. Guests can also enjoy the beloved Bel Burger ($13.00), stacked with caramelized onions, cheddar, lettuce, pickles, and signature burger sauce on a soft potato bun.

To complement these seasonal treats, Bel Café introduces a trio of winter beverages: the nutty Hazelnut Hojicha Latte ($6.00), the refreshing Peppermint Hot Chocolate ($6.25) topped with mint whipped cream, and the festive Holiday Nog Latte ($6.50) made with house-made plant-based nog, oat milk, fig, and warm spice.

About Bel Café

David Hawksworth’s Bel Café combines expertly prepared food and beverages with efficient and friendly service. A selection of ‘ready to go’ items feature fresh baked pastries, gourmet sandwiches, salads, nourishing soups, and delicate desserts. Specialty coffees are custom roasted locally and served by a team of highly trained baristas. Artisan teas, fresh pressed juices, and local lattes are also available. Bel Café is located at 801 West Georgia Street at The Rosewood Hotel Georgia. Bel Café is open from 7am until 5pm Monday through Friday and from 8am until 4pm on weekends.
